How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Village at Town Center?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Village at Town Center Studio Apartments | $1,655 | $1,295 | $3,406 |
| Village at Town Center 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,667 | $1,200 | $3,697 |
| Village at Town Center 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,930 | $1,528 | $4,359 |
| Village at Town Center 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,486 | $1,684 | $5,545 |
| Village at Town Center 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,335 | $1,894 | $5,089 |
